এক্সেল একটি ক্যালকুলেটর বা সাধারণ ডেটা বিশ্লেষণ টুলের চেয়ে অনেক বেশি। সঠিকভাবে লিভারেজ করা হলে, এটি অত্যাধুনিক ওয়ার্কফ্লো সমাধান তৈরির জন্য একটি শক্তিশালী প্ল্যাটফর্ম হয়ে ওঠে যা প্রক্রিয়াগুলিকে স্বয়ংক্রিয় করতে পারে, জটিল ডেটা সম্পর্কগুলি পরিচালনা করতে পারে এবং সিদ্ধান্ত নেওয়ার জন্য রিয়েল-টাইম অন্তর্দৃষ্টি প্রদান করতে পারে। সমস্ত আকারের ব্যবসাগুলি প্রক্রিয়াগুলি পরিচালনা করতে, অগ্রগতি ট্র্যাক করতে এবং পুনরাবৃত্তিমূলক কাজগুলি স্বয়ংক্রিয় করতে Excel ব্যবহার করে৷
এই টিউটোরিয়ালে, আমরা দেখাব কিভাবে সাধারণ স্প্রেডশীটকে এক্সেলের সাহায্যে শক্তিশালী ওয়ার্কফ্লো টুলে রূপান্তর করা যায়।
সাধারণ উদাহরণ:
- টাস্ক এবং প্রজেক্ট ট্র্যাকার।
- ছুটি বা ছুটির অনুমোদন প্রবাহিত হয়।
- সেলস অর্ডার প্রসেসিং।
- ইনভেন্টরি ম্যানেজমেন্ট।
- সামগ্রী পর্যালোচনা/অনুমোদন পাইপলাইন।
একটি এক্সেল ওয়ার্কফ্লো টুলের মূল উপাদান
Excel এ একটি শক্তিশালী ওয়ার্কফ্লো টুল সাধারণত অন্তর্ভুক্ত করে:
- ইনপুট শীট: যেখানে ব্যবহারকারীরা নতুন ডেটা বা অনুরোধ (যেমন, নতুন কাজ, অনুরোধ ছেড়ে) প্রবেশ করেন।
- স্থিতি ট্র্যাকিং: প্রতিটি আইটেমের অগ্রগতি/স্থিতি নির্দেশ করার জন্য একটি কলাম।
- স্বয়ংক্রিয় ট্রিগার: শর্তাধীন বিন্যাস বা সূত্র যা স্থিতি পরিবর্তনে সাড়া দেয়।
- ড্যাশবোর্ড: অগ্রগতি বা প্রতিবন্ধকতা কল্পনা করার জন্য সারাংশ ভিউ বা চার্ট।
- বিজ্ঞপ্তি/অটোমেশন: VBA ম্যাক্রো বা পাওয়ার স্বয়ংক্রিয় প্রবাহ সতর্কতা পাঠাতে বা বর্ধিত ক্রিয়াকলাপের জন্য।
আসুন শুরু থেকে একটি ব্যবহারিক টাস্ক ট্র্যাকার ওয়ার্কফ্লো তৈরি করি।
ধাপ 1:আপনার ডেটা টেবিল সেট আপ করুন
- এক্সেল খুলুন।
- একটি নতুন ওয়ার্কশীট তৈরি করুন, এটির নাম টাস্কস৷ ৷
- হয় আপনার ডেটা ইনপুট করুন বা বিভিন্ন উত্স থেকে ডেটা আমদানি করুন৷
- হেডার সহ একটি স্ট্রাকচার্ড টেবিল তৈরি করুন।
- পরিসীমা নির্বাচন করুন।
- ডেটা-এ যান ট্যাব>> টেবিল নির্বাচন করুন অথবা Ctrl + T টিপুন .
- চেক করুন "আমার টেবিলে হেডার আছে" .
- ঠিক আছে ক্লিক করুন .

- টেবিলের নাম পরিবর্তন করুন:
- টেবিল ডিজাইন এ যান ট্যাব>> টেবিলের নাম নির্বাচন করুন (যেমন, tblWorkflow)।

ধাপ 2:স্ট্যাটাস ট্র্যাকিং যোগ করুন
স্থিতি এর জন্য একটি ড্রপডাউন তৈরি করুন৷ কলাম।
- ডেটা -এ যান ট্যাব>> ডেটা যাচাইকরণ নির্বাচন করুন .
- এ অনুমতি দিন: তালিকা নির্বাচন করুন .
- সূত্রে: পরিসর থেকে টাইপ বা নির্বাচন করুন;
Not Started, In Progress, Complete, Blocked
- ঠিক আছে ক্লিক করুন .

ধাপ 3:শর্তসাপেক্ষ বিন্যাস প্রয়োগ করুন
কাজগুলিকে তাদের অবস্থার উপর ভিত্তি করে আলাদা করে তুলুন৷
৷- স্থিতি নির্বাচন করুন কলাম।
- হোম এ যান৷ ট্যাব>> শর্তসাপেক্ষ বিন্যাস নির্বাচন করুন>> হাইলাইট সেল নিয়ম নির্বাচন করুন>> যে পাঠ্য রয়েছে নির্বাচন করুন .

- প্রগতিতে আছে → রঙ পূরণ করুন:কমলা .
- ঠিক আছে ক্লিক করুন .

- শুরু হয়নি → রঙ পূরণ করুন:হলুদ .
- সম্পূর্ণ৷ → রঙ পূরণ করুন:সবুজ .
- অবরুদ্ধ৷ → রঙ পূরণ করুন:লাল .

- ঐচ্ছিকভাবে, আপনি দৃশ্যত অবস্থা ট্র্যাক করতে আইকন সেট প্রয়োগ করতে পারেন।
পদক্ষেপ 4:স্বয়ংক্রিয় ওভারডিউ ফ্ল্যাগ যোগ করুন
অতিরিক্ত কাজ শনাক্ত করতে একটি সহায়ক কলাম সন্নিবেশ করুন৷
- একটি ঘর নির্বাচন করুন এবং নিম্নলিখিত সূত্রটি সন্নিবেশ করুন।
=IF(AND([@Status]<>"Complete",[@Due Date]<TODAY()),"Overdue","")

প্রগতি গণনা:
আপনি যদি একটি % সমাপ্তি মেট্রিক তৈরি করতে চান:
- একটি ঘর নির্বাচন করুন এবং নিম্নলিখিত সূত্রটি সন্নিবেশ করুন।
=SWITCH([@Status], "Complete", 1, "In Progress", 0.5, "Not Started", 0, "Blocked", 0.25, "")
- শতাংশ হিসাবে সেল ফর্ম্যাট করুন।

ধাপ 5:একটি ড্যাশবোর্ড তৈরি করুন
একটি PivotTable সন্নিবেশ করান বা টাস্ক ট্র্যাকারের সংক্ষিপ্তসার করতে COUNTIF সূত্র ব্যবহার করুন৷
পিভট টেবিল তৈরি করুন:
- ঢোকান-এ যান ট্যাব>> পিভটটেবল নির্বাচন করুন .
- অবস্থান নির্বাচন করুন: নতুন ওয়ার্কশীট .
- ঠিক আছে ক্লিক করুন .

পিভটটেবল ফিল্ডে;
- টেনে আনুন টাস্কের নাম সারিতে ক্ষেত্র।
- টেনে আনুন স্থিতি কলাম ক্ষেত্রে।
- টেনে আনুন স্থিতি মান ক্ষেত্রে।

- ড্যাশবোর্ডের জন্য এই পিভট টেবিলগুলি তৈরি করুন৷
- ৷
- স্থিতি অনুসারে কাজ।
- অতিরিক্ত কাজ।
- জন প্রতি কাজ।
চার্ট তৈরি করুন:
- ভিজ্যুয়ালাইজ করার জন্য সহজ চার্ট (বার/পাই) তৈরি করুন।
- পিভটটেবিল বিশ্লেষণ-এ যান ট্যাব>> পাই নির্বাচন করুন চার্ট।
- ঠিক আছে ক্লিক করুন .

- বার তৈরি করুন দলের সদস্যদের জন্য চার্ট।
ড্যাশবোর্ড:

ধাপ 6:VBA এর সাথে ওয়ার্কফ্লো অটোমেশন যোগ করুন
আপনি কর্মপ্রবাহ স্বয়ংক্রিয় করতে VBA ব্যবহার করতে পারেন। ওভারডু কাজের জন্য ইমেল অনুস্মারক পাঠানোর মত।
- ডেভেলপার-এ যান ট্যাব>> ভিজ্যুয়াল বেসিক নির্বাচন করুন .
- সন্নিবেশ এ যান ট্যাব>> মডিউল নির্বাচন করুন .
- নিম্নলিখিত VBA কোড কপি-পেস্ট করুন।

Sub RemindOverdueTasks()
Dim ws As Worksheet
Set ws = ThisWorkbook.Sheets("Tasks")
Dim lastRow As Long
lastRow = ws.Cells(ws.Rows.Count, "A").End(xlUp).Row
Dim overdueMsg As String
Dim hasOverdue As Boolean
hasOverdue = False
Dim i As Long
For i = 2 To lastRow 'Assume row 1 is header
' Column H = Overdue?; Column B = Task Name; Column E = Due Date
If LCase(ws.Cells(i, "H").Value) = "overdue" Then
hasOverdue = True
overdueMsg = overdueMsg & "Task: " & ws.Cells(i, "B").Value & _
vbCrLf & "Due Date: " & ws.Cells(i, "E").Text & _
vbCrLf & "Assigned To: " & ws.Cells(i, "C").Value & _
vbCrLf & "Status: " & ws.Cells(i, "F").Value & vbCrLf & vbCrLf
End If
Next i
If hasOverdue Then
MsgBox "Overdue Tasks:" & vbCrLf & vbCrLf & overdueMsg, vbExclamation, "Overdue Task Reminder"
Else
MsgBox "No overdue tasks found!", vbInformation, "All Clear"
End If
End Sub
- টাস্ক ওয়ার্কশীটের সমস্ত সারি দিয়ে ম্যাক্রো লুপ করে।
- যদি কলাম H বলে "অতিরিক্ত", এটি বিশদ সংগ্রহ করে।
- কোনও অতিরিক্ত কাজ পাওয়া গেলে, এটি একটি তালিকা পপ আপ করে।
- কোনটি না হলে, এটি "সমস্ত পরিষ্কার" বলে।
কোড চালান:
- ডেভেলপার-এ যান ট্যাব>> ম্যাক্রো নির্বাচন করুন .
- RemindOverdueTasks নির্বাচন করুন>> চালান এ ক্লিক করুন .

ফলাফল:

কার্যকর এক্সেল ওয়ার্কফ্লোসের জন্য সর্বোত্তম অনুশীলন
- ডাইনামিক রেঞ্জ এবং সহজ রেফারেন্সের জন্য টেবিল ব্যবহার করুন।
- ডেটা যাচাইকরণ এবং শীট সুরক্ষা ব্যবহার করে সম্পাদনা সীমাবদ্ধ করুন।
- ব্যবহারকারীর স্পষ্ট নির্দেশাবলী যোগ করুন (যেমন, একটি "নির্দেশ" শীট)।
- রোল আউট করার আগে বাস্তব-বিশ্বের পরিস্থিতির সাথে আপনার কর্মপ্রবাহ পরীক্ষা করুন।
- নিয়মিত ব্যাকআপ এবং সংস্করণ-নিয়ন্ত্রণ কী ওয়ার্কফ্লো টেমপ্লেট।
উপসংহার
উপরের ধাপগুলি অনুসরণ করে, আপনি Excel এ ওয়ার্কফ্লো টুল তৈরি করতে পারেন। এক্সেল একটি সাধারণ স্প্রেডশীট থেকে আপনার দলের জন্য একটি ব্যবহারিক ওয়ার্কফ্লো ইঞ্জিনে রূপান্তরিত হতে পারে। আপনার ডেটা গঠন করে, ডেটা যাচাইকরণ এবং শর্তসাপেক্ষ ফর্ম্যাটিং-এর মতো অন্তর্নির্মিত বৈশিষ্ট্যগুলি ব্যবহার করে, এবং সূত্র বা VBA-এর মাধ্যমে অটোমেশন যোগ করে, আপনি সময় বাঁচাতে এবং ত্রুটিগুলি কমাতে উপযুক্ত ওয়ার্কফ্লো সমাধান তৈরি করতে পারেন৷
সমাধান সহ বিনামূল্যে উন্নত এক্সেল ব্যায়াম পান!